Carlisle Support Services is recruiting a Passenger Service Agent to support the UK travel hub. You’ll welcome passengers, provide clear information, assist with check-in, boarding and safety procedures, and help manage traffic flow in a busy environment.
This role requires a friendly, professional appearance, strong communication skills, and the ability to stay calm under pressure. Full training is provided, and you’ll join a safety‑critical, customer‑facing team at a major transport gateway.

Carlisle Support Services is proud to partner with Le Shuttle Eurotunnel), the vital transport link connecting the UK and France. Together, we help operate one of Europe’s most important travel gateways — safely, efficiently, and with exceptional customer care.
We are now recruiting Passenger Service Agents to support this unique, safety-critical operation. This is your opportunity to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ment where no two days are the same.

As a Passenger Service Agent, you’ll play a vital role in every traveller’s journey. You’ll provide reassurance, guidance, and support to passengers while helping manage vehicle and passenger flow in a busy operational environment.
This isn’t just a job — it’s a chance to be part of a professional, personable team at one of Europe’s most significant transport hubs.
Experience in traffic management, marshalling, or HGV handling is advantageous but not essential — full training will be provided.
